Charging station

The charging station for electric vehicles is an essential device that allows to charge an electric vehicle safely and efficiently. Unlike a standard domestic socket, the electric terminal is designed to ensure the safety of both goods, such as the vehicle itself and the electrical installation, as well as people using the terminal.

Extension of charging stations: a catalyst for the adoption of electric vehicles

The charging station consists of various elements, such as a contactor, an electronic card and various security equipment. These elements work together to provide reliable electric power supply to the electric vehicle while guaranteeing protection against surge, short circuit and other potentially dangerous electrical incidents.

Recharge Point Controller: the key to the safety and compliance of charging stations

A crucial aspect of the installation of charging stations is the charging point controller. This device allows to monitor and control different charging stations and electric vehicles during the charging process. Recharge point controllers are designed to perform standard checks to ensure that load stations meet the requirements of the applicable standards. They play a key role in the development, production, installation and maintenance of charging stations.

Safety is a major concern when it comes to charging an electric vehicle, and this is where the charging point controller intervenes. It allows to verify whether the load stations comply with the existing safety standards, which ensures that vehicles can be reloaded with confidence. In addition, charging point controllers are able to detect and report potential problems, such as power failures or anomalies in the charging system, in order to prevent risks and ensure safe use of charging stations.

Power optimization and facilitation of the adoption of electric vehicles

In addition to their safety role, charging point controllers also offer advanced features to optimize the efficiency of charging. They allow to manage and control the load power according to the availability of electricity and the demand of vehicles. This allows to balance the load on the power grid and avoid overloads or consumption peaks that could cause stability problems. In addition, charging point controllers can be integrated into energy management systems to optimize electricity consumption and reduce costs.
